Output 6882a95a84171fdc960deb8bd4e8c04cd8cb0b6b09cac786467df480f95cb8ce:11

value
3498194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8f8c9e7a176d1e6ad5fc9e6fbe57cab65261ba1 OP_EQUALVERIFY OP_CHECKSIG
address
1PhSciUzSwFN3C5pcTihB5NaxG2fDt8Ktq
transaction
6882a95a84171fdc960deb8bd4e8c04cd8cb0b6b09cac786467df480f95cb8ce
spent
true